Understanding Why Regulation Can Be Challenging

Emotional regulation develops gradually and is closely connected to the nervous system. Common contributors to regulation challenges include sensory processing differences, anxiety, attention differences, developmental delays, sleep disruption, environmental stress, or difficulty with transitions. Some children have strong emotional responses because their bodies struggle to process input efficiently.

In-home pediatric therapy allows therapists to observe how emotional responses show up during real routines such as mealtime, homework, or bedtime. Timely support helps children learn how their bodies respond to stress and how to use movement, breathing, and structured routines to return to a calm state. Therapy focuses on skill building rather than behavior correction. When children develop body awareness and coping strategies, daily life often feels more predictable and manageable.

Signs Parents May Notice

Children experiencing emotional regulation challenges may show:

  • Intense reactions to small frustrations
  • Difficulty calming after becoming upset
  • Frequent meltdowns during transitions
  • Avoidance of certain environments or activities
  • Impulsive responses
  • Sensitivity to noise, touch, or crowds
  • Difficulty focusing when overwhelmed
  • Physical signs of stress such as muscle tension or rapid breathing
  • Trouble shifting from preferred to nonpreferred tasks

An individualized evaluation helps determine how sensory, motor, and environmental factors influence emotional responses.

Building Body Awareness and Calming Strategies

At EMpower, therapists use in-home pediatric physical and occupational therapy as part of a personalized plan to support emotional regulation.

  • Comprehensive sensory assessment identifies triggers and patterns that affect a child’s nervous system.
  • Structured movement activities provide organized sensory input that supports calmer responses.
  • Breathing and body awareness exercises help children recognize early signs of stress and respond more effectively.
  • Routine-based strategies create predictable transitions that reduce emotional overload.
  • Core strengthening and postural work support physical stability, which can improve overall regulation.
  • Environmental modifications reduce sensory triggers within the home setting.
  • Caregiver coaching and communication tools help families respond consistently and calmly during challenging moments.

In-home pediatric physical and occupational therapy works best when guided by individual evaluation and ongoing collaboration with families. Plans adjust as children develop new skills and coping strategies.
